Şimdi Ara

Kaynak kodlarına erişilemeyecek program yoktur

Bu Konudaki Kullanıcılar:
2 Misafir - 2 Masaüstü
5 sn
15
Cevap
0
Favori
2.063
Tıklama
Daha Fazla
İstatistik
  • Konu İstatistikleri Yükleniyor
0 oy
Öne Çıkar
Sayfa: 1
Giriş
Mesaj
  • Kaynak kodlarına erişilemeyecek program yoktur.

    Acaba cok buyuk bir iddiami?

    Bir program yazarken, program icinde tarafimizdan verilmis fonksiyon isimleri, Label isimleri, procedure isimleri, degisken isimleri,
    hatta satirlarin sagina soluna serpistirilmis kisisel aciklamalar kaynak kodunun anlasilirligini etkiler. Hatta programin en tepesine programin ne amacla yazildigi bile, ileride kodlara bakan kisi icin cok onemli bir bilgidir.

    Programi yazdiktan cok sonra tekrar kodlari incelerken programi anlamamizda yukaridaki isimlendirmeler isimizi cok kolaylastirir.

    Exe haline getirilmis bir program da aslinda makine dilinde kaynak bir koddur. Ne is yaptigini, ne tur algoritmalar kullandigini coook uzun ve hummali bir calisma sonunda anlasilabilir.

    En azindan disassembler ile programin text versiyonu elde ederiz.

    Peki yuksek duzeyli bir dille yazilmis ve derlenmis bir programdan tersine gitmek yani kaynak kodlara erismek mumkunmudur?

    Bence evet, en azindan o dil icin derleyicisini yazan adamlar icin fazla zor olmasa gerek.

    Discompiler olarak isimlendirecegim bu programlarin, insan zekasinin ozenle sectigi degisken vs isimlendirmelerinden uzak belki de sadece harf ve rakamlardan olusturacagi isimler programin kolayca anlasilirligini saglamayacak olsa da eldeki yari islenmis kodlarla, programin gizemli pek cok algoritmasi su ustune cikartilir diye dusunuyorum.

    Bu konudaki goruslerinizi ogrenmek istiyorum.

    Bu tur tersine calisma ne kadar etkili bir calisma olur. Kullanilan tekniklermidir?



  • Kücük normal programlarinki bulursun.
    Ama Windowsunki kasar,yani decompiler ile resmini cekecen,ve sonra onu dogru dürüst okunabilir hale getircen.
    Bunu yapabilmen icin belki 2-3 seneni veririrsin.

    Ha burda daha hic program dili ile urasmadim,ama baslamaya düsünüyorum,ve cogu kisi de bunu söyledi bana.
  • doğru diyorsun fakat bu zaman kadar aşamadığım tek bir sistem var.
    sıkıştırma ve şifreleme yöntemlrinin bir çoğu çok rahat bir şekilde kırılaibliyor.ama bird anti monitoring yazımları programa dump edilmiş ise iş gerçekten zor hatta imkansız gibi birşey istersen dene bu program gerçekten imkansıza yakın adı şuan aklımda değil. daha sonra kesinlikle yazacağım. ama tabiki kırılabilir. ama gerçekten bu zaman kadarki en zor şifrelemeolduğunu söylemeliyim
  • Kaynak kodlarına erişilemeyecek program yoktur...

    Kesinlikle doğru bir iddia.. Reverse Engineering yapılarak her türlü program çözülebilir..

    Örnek vereyim;

    Salamender diye bir program var hangi dil ile yazılmış olursa olsun C# sourceları olarak açıyor kodları.. Çalışırken de gördüm ama o zaman beni pek enterese etmemişti.. Keşke şimdi olsa o program
  • şimdi doğru mu bilmiyorum ama...arkadaşım söylemişti ben onun yalancısıyım:) underground'ın da C# kodlarının cd'nin içinden çıktıını söylemişti
  • ben merak ediyorum , exe ahline getirilmiş bi program sonuçta label işsmlerinide içeriyo yordamların adlarınıda , bunları bilgisayar bu sekilde çözüyo , niye madem decompiler gibi programlarla geri alınamasın
  • Güvenlik programlarının dahi crack'ı yapılıyorsa neden olmasın?
  • Divx 'i microsoft'un mpeg4 codec'inden böyle kırdılar. 10 kişilik bir ekip mpeg4'ü alıp haftalarca makine kodunu inceleyip çalışma mantığını çıkardılar sonra divx diye piyasaya çıkardılar.

    Iddia doğru mudur bilemiyorum fakat çok zaman alacağı kesindir.

    Eğer kolay bir iş olsaydı MS Windows'un yüzlerce rakibi olurdu. Windows'un kaynak kodu hala yoktur.
  • assembeler dilinin neyi nerede kullanacağımızı neye göre belirleyeceğiz bununla ilgili döküman veya açıklama varmı?
  • Bu doğru bir varsayım fakat buyuk yazılımlarda çok zor.Mesela open ofice programını windovs office formatını çalıştıracak şekle sokmaya çalışıyorlar ve bunun için bahsettiğin tersine gitme yolunu kullanıyorlar ilerleme var fakat yavalş ama yakında halledeceklerine inanıyorum
  • aylar öncede burada yazmıştım...
    geçen yıl bende bir program vardı. ama bilgsyr çöktü ve o program silindi bende adını unuttum...

    o programın özelliği her tür dosyayı açabilmesiydi..
    açılmayan exe leri ve her tür açılması mümkün olmayan dosyayı sadece üzerine sürükleyince açıyordu...

    sanırım chıp dergisinin verdiği cdlerden çıkmış ama emin değilim...
    kuran kişi başka bazı programları chıp cd lerinden kurmuştu ama onu nerden yükledi bilmiyorum...

    bu programı buradada çok sordum aradım ama bilen biri çıkmadı...
  • arkadaslar bir programın exe halini verip kaynak kodlarını satır satır çıkaran program araştırmama rağmen çıkmadı fakat decompile ederek program içindeki sabitleri ve makina koduna çevvrilmiş haliyle program hakkında ipucu elde edebiliriz en azından fikrimiz olur yoksa kaynak kodunun satır satır bulan program daha duymaddım
  • Java ve .net ile yazılmış programların kodları onlar için yazılmış decompiler larla kodları değişken isimleri ile beraebr direk görebilirsiniz. (.net in böyle olduğunu duydum tam olarak bilmiyorum), ama exe haline gelmiş bir programı anlamak baya zor olsa gerek özelliklede büyük bir programı
  • analmak zor olduğu kadar
    debug anında anti ontironig özelliği işi mod ediyor
    xprotector(xstream) isimli exe şifrelem programı tam bir deha ürünü ve bunu şifrelediği exe leri kırmak imkansız gibi bir şey neredeyse tüm güçlü debug progamalrını tanıyor bunu tek yolu mac ya da linux üerinde çalışarak kırmaya çalışmak mam oradada suprizler çıkabilir çünkü addamlar akla gelmeyecek güvenlik önlemleri almışlar walla ben aşamadım aşanada helal
  • 
Sayfa: 1
- x
Bildirim
mesajınız kopyalandı (ctrl+v) yapıştırmak istediğiniz yere yapıştırabilirsiniz.